Bitcoin ETF flows have shifted out of the strong-outflows regime and into a neutral one, but neutral flows don’t historically support sustained upside.
In ETF flow data, we usually see three regimes: strong inflows, neutral flows, and strong outflows.
Rallies backed by strong inflows tend to persist. Rallies without flow support rarely do.
That’s why understanding these regimes matters.
Right now, Bitcoin is sitting in the neutral flows regime, which neither pushes the market higher nor provides a foundation for a durable recovery.

That positioning lines up with the current macro uncertainty. After today’s FOMC meeting, we may get a clearer macro signal and flows will pick a direction once investors have more conviction.
